Taylor Swift's new Love Story
Singer Taylor Swift, 27, is secretly dating actor Joe Alwyn, 26, say British reports. According to The Sun, she has been renting a house in North London while spending time with Alwyn, who had a breakthrough role in the 2016 Lee Ang film Billy Lynn's Long Halftime Walk.
A source is quoted as saying: "Taylor and Joe are the real deal. This is a very serious relationship. But after what happened with Tom Hiddleston, they were determined to keep it quiet."
Swift's three-month romance with actor Hiddleston, 36, last year was catalogued in paparazzi shots and viewed as a publicity stunt.
Jimmy Fallon regrets going soft on Trump
In a New York Times interview published on Wednesday, Tonight Show host Jimmy Fallon acknowledged that viewers "have a right to be mad" about his softball interview with then-presidential candidate Donald Trump last year. "If I let anyone down, it hurt my feelings that they didn't like it. I got it," he said.
He said the hair-touching moment was not meant to "humanise him". "I almost did it to minimise him. I didn't think that would be a compliment."
Katy Perry to judge on American Idol American pop star
Katy Perry will serve as a judge on the revival of American Idol, part of ABC network's 2017-2018 season. The other judges have not been announced. The show, which pulled in 38 million viewers at its peak, aired for 15 seasons before it was cancelled last year amid declining ratings.
